Transaction 303abf34d451e97325655548ae9786defd081940605a219e250da3a3dec5b2fc
1 Input
1 Output
-
303abf34d451e97325655548ae9786defd081940605a219e250da3a3dec5b2fc:0
- value
- 255981
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0057c5dd49565ec24497bc8516a56c0c196b069d OP_EQUAL
- address
- 31iq57U3UUSJT4JH6XWR3so4jVJ2NCzBCf